Where does “spermatocystitis” come from?
spermatocystitis (English) comes from English spermatocyst, from English cyst, from Latin cystis, from Ancient Greek κύστις, from Proto-Indo-European (s)kewH- — to cover, bedeck; cover.
spermatocystitis (English): inflammation of the seminal vesicles
